Body & Dimensions

The Wizard is a 5-seater SUV with 5 doors and a length of 4515 mm (177.76 in), width of 1785 mm (70.28 in) and height of 1740 mm (68.5 in). It has a wheelbase of 2700 mm (106.3 in), with a front and rear track of 1515 mm (59.65 in) and 1520 mm (59.84 in) respectively.

Engine & Transmission

The Wizard boasts a powerful 3.2L V-6 engine generating 215 hp and 284 Nm of torque. Its all-wheel-drive system and automatic transmission ensure confident handling and effortless acceleration.

Weight & Capacity

The Wizard model has a weight-to-power ratio of 8.8 kg/Hp (113.8 Hp/tonne) and a weight-to-torque ratio of 6.7 kg/Nm (150.3 Nm/tonne). It has a kerb weight of 1890 kg (4166.74 lbs.) and a fuel tank capacity of 80 l (21.13 US gal | 17.6 UK gal).
